Special taskforce to deal with Ashanti registration violence

August 11, 2014

The Ashanti Regional Police Command has established a special task force to deal with the increasing cases of violence which has characterized the on-going limited voters registration exercise in the region.

Some of the equipment of the Electoral Commission [EC] was destroyed by an unknown group of persons on Friday while another individual was stabbed in the stomach at Abrotia.

As such, the Police Regional Commander of the area, DCOP Nathan Kofi Boakye in an interview with Citi News is asking persons assaulted by supporters of  either the National Democratic Party (NDC) or the New Patriotic Party (NPP) to report the incident at the nearest police station.

He pledged that, the Ashanti Police force would do their work without fear or favor.

DCOP Kofi Boakye noted that, 120 police officers will be deployed across the region to go to every station” and oversee the on-going registration exercise.

The Electoral Commission, on Monday August 4, began a nationwide process across 6,000 centres, to register Ghanaians who turned 18 after the 2012 general elections and adults who could not register during the previous registration exercises.
